Understanding Indian Gambling Law

In India, the legality of gambling, including online betting, is governed by various laws. The most significant of these is the Public Gambling Act of 1867. This act primarily prohibits the operation of public gambling houses and does not directly address online gambling, leading to a grey area in its interpretation.

Skill vs. Chance

One of the fundamental distinctions in Indian gambling law is between games of skill and games of chance. Betting on the IPL can often fall under games of skill, especially when you consider factors like player statistics and match conditions. State-wise Gambling Laws

Different states in India have varying regulations concerning gambling and betting. While some states are more liberal, others impose strict restrictions. Here’s a quick overview:

  • States with Complete Bans: Telangana, Andhra Pradesh, Tamil Nadu, Odisha, and Assam have laws that outright ban online betting.
  • States with Legal Frameworks: States like Goa and Sikkim have their own regulations allowing certain forms of online betting and casinos.
  • States with No Clear Regulations: Many states do not explicitly address online gambling, creating a legal grey area for apps.

Recent Court Rulings and Their Impact

Recent court rulings have also played a pivotal role in shaping the landscape of online betting in India. Courts have generally leaned towards recognizing skill-based games as legal. For example, the Supreme Court of India ruled in favor of games of skill, thereby allowing fantasy sports platforms and other similar apps to operate.

The Role of the Reserve Bank of India (RBI)

The Reserve Bank of India (RBI) plays a significant role in regulating financial transactions related to online gambling. While the RBI does not directly govern online betting, it influences the legality through its payment regulations.
